Mr. Rojas was looking through a microscope at some similar cells. He noticed that every cell had a different structure. What can he infer about these cells? * They are from different organisms. They have the same organelles. They have the same functions. They have different functions.

Answers

Answer 1
Answer:

Answer:

They have different functions.

Explanation:

The cells having different structures may come from the same organism and having different structures may result from having different organelles. Due to the structure function correlation in cells, it is thus likely that the different structures arise from different functions, hence cells are specialised structurally to optimise performance in their functions.

Multiple alleles _____. a. can interact and influence a trait such as eye color, b. cannot interact to influence traitsc. that interact are always sex linked
d.are made of RNA

Answers

Answer:

The correct answer would be option A. It can interact and influence a trait such as eye color.

Explanation:

Three or more alternative alleles of a gene that can occupy the same locus known as multiple allele condition. However, only two of the alleles can be present.

The ABO blood group system and human eye color are examples of the multiple allele condition.

Eye color is determined by multiple genes. OCA2 and HERC2  Both are located on human chromosome 15. A common polymorphism in the HERC2 gene is accountable for the blue eye. A person with homozygous TT predicts likely to have brown eyes, while a person with 2 copies of C allele at HERC2 rs1293832 will have blue eyes.
